Well since cydia lists 4.2.1 then you should be able to restore to that version.
Before you do open up TU again, go advanced and Check the box that says "set hosts to cydia on exit."
This way when itunes requests the blobs cydia will have them available.
Then follow this tutorial to create a custom 4.2.1 with pwnage tool and restore to that.
http://www.iclarified.com/entry/index.php?enid=13931
Once you do that, open up cydia and install ultrasnow to unlock.

Solved the problem. I have a Mac. Shift+click only works on Windows. On a Mac you should hold down the Option key.
 
Hold the option key down and then click restore. It will then let u select the custom ipsw u created with pwnage.
